Judith Mobbs

Judith Mobbs

Woodbridge Community Church member

Updated: Thursday, May 8, 2008 10:38 PM PDT

Judith Marie Mobbs, 63, of Acampo, died May 6 in a local hospital. She was born on March 26, 1945, in Grand Rapids, Mich.

Mrs. Mobbs resided in Acampo for the last 41 years. She worked for General Mills and was later employed with Mondavi Winery, having a combined employment of over 40 years. She was a member of the Woodbridge Community Church and active in the Women's Ministry. She enjoyed spending time with her grandchildren, shopping and ceramics.

She is survived by her husband, Vernon L. Mobbs, of Acampo; daughters, Leanna Mobbs, of Stockton, Vickie Jenkins, of Reno, Nev., Sherry Preston, of Stockton, Debbie Mobbs, of Modesto, Verna Badasci, of Madera, and Diane Orozco, of Galt; sons, Royal Mobbs and Tim Mobbs, both of Acampo, and David Mobbs, of Fort Smith, Ark.; sisters, Carol Coburn, of Minn., and Adelia "Dea" Moore, of Va.; brother, Bud Moen, of Minn.; 14 grandchildren and 15 great-grandchildren.

A graveside service will be held at 11 a.m. Thursday in Lodi Memorial Cemetery with Rev. Sammie P. Walls officiating. Visitation will be held from 1 to 5 p.m. Saturday and Sunday at Donahue Funeral Home, 123 N. School St., Lodi.
